People fear carbon capture might worsen climate change - Vimarsana News

People fear carbon capture might worsen climate change

Polly Glover realized her son had asthma when he was nine months old. Now 26, he carries an inhaler in his pocket whenever he is out and about in Prairieville, Louisiana, part of Ascension Parish. “He probably needs to leave Ascension quite frankly,” Glover said, but he has not because “this is his home and this is our family and this is our community.” The parish is part of the 137km span between New Orleans and Baton Rouge officially called the Mississippi River Chemical Corridor, more commonly known as “Cancer Alley.” The region’s air quality is some of the worst in the US,
